[QUOTE=TOOL_FAQ] Justin uses Wal basses (which he fell for while recording "Ænima"), cabinets by Mesa/Boogie (8 inch speakers), pre-amp by Demeter. Effects: Boss Delay, Chorus, Flanger, and Distortion pedals, and a DigiTech Bass Whammy pedal, used occasionally (for example, at the beginnings of "Third Eye" and "Eulogy".)[/QUOTE]

At least he is one of the featured artists on the Mesa Boogie site.[/QUOTE] He does also use Mesa Boogie. I believe he uses three different amps in conjuction with one another: Mesa Boogie, Marshall, and Deizel with 2 Mesa cabinets and a Marshall cabinet. |
^ Switching from one song to another or during songs? Just wondering.
|
No, he uses them all at the same time, each playing a different role. Something along the lines of using one for bass, one for mids, and one for treble. Not sure if it's that straightforward, but it has something to do with that.
|
In other words, he uses way more amps than he really needs. :p
|
Well, he's really picky on his sound. He tweaks each amp to get just the rigth settings for his tones. Hell, if I had the money to do so I'd do the same thing. He says he uses the Marshall and then the other amps to "fill in the gaps" and bring out each amps' strenghts and weaknesses (ie, what the Marshall lacks in bass, the Diezel fills in for it)
